Proposed Integration Framework
To bridge Flickr and 500px, we propose leveraging an integration framework that utilizes API endpoints provided by both platforms. APIs are crucial as they allow AI spreadsheet agents to access and manipulate data efficiently. By employing standardized data exchange formats such as JSON or XML, we can ensure that information flows smoothly between the platforms. For example, using the Flickr API, AI agents can extract metadata like image titles, tags, and upload dates, while the 500px API can be used to access licensing data and download statistics.
To ensure the robustness of this framework, it is essential to implement a data mapping strategy. This involves identifying common fields and attributes across both platforms, ensuring that AI agents can translate data accurately. For instance, mapping Flickr's "tags" to the equivalent "keywords" in 500px can help in maintaining consistency.

Step-by-Step Guide to Setting Up Workflows
- Define Your Objectives: Begin by identifying the specific tasks you want to automate. This could include synchronizing photo uploads, updating metadata, or generating reports on photo performance. Clear objectives will guide your workflow design.
- Select Your AI Spreadsheet Agent: Choose a robust AI spreadsheet platform like Microsoft Excel's Agent Mode, which can handle complex workflows. Ensure it supports API connectivity and custom scripting for maximum flexibility.
- Connect to Flickr and 500px APIs: Obtain API keys for both Flickr and 500px. These platforms offer comprehensive APIs that allow you to access and manage your photo collections programmatically. Follow their documentation to authenticate your AI agent.
- Design the Workflow: Utilize the AI spreadsheet agent to create automated workflows. For instance, design scripts to fetch new photos from Flickr, apply any necessary edits or metadata updates, and then upload them to 500px. Leverage the agent's capabilities to monitor changes and trigger actions accordingly.
- Test and Iterate: Run initial tests to ensure the workflows function as expected. Pay attention to data accuracy and process efficiency. Gather feedback and make necessary adjustments to optimize the integration.
- Monitor and Maintain: Once operational, continuously monitor the workflows for errors or changes in the API structures. Regular maintenance will ensure the integration remains effective and adapts to any updates in the platforms.
Tools and Technologies Required
To implement this integration, you will need:
- AI Spreadsheet Platform: Microsoft Excel's Agent Mode or equivalent, providing support for API interactions and advanced scripting capabilities.
- API Access: Valid API keys for Flickr and 500px to facilitate seamless data exchange.
- Programming Knowledge: Familiarity with scripting languages such as Python or JavaScript to customize workflows and handle API requests efficiently.
